Somewhat off topic, but thalidomide has killed more people than any other drug in history. Not directly, but by causing a massive ratcheting up in the testing and red tape required to release a new drug. This has lead to the cost become so huge that whole disease areas are no longer economic to develop new drugs. The regulators have become so worried about approving another thalidomide that they make the hurdle for a new drug rediculously high by requiring an enormous amount of testing be done before release.
